Question : Cholesterol is related to _____.
Option 1: fat
Option 2: starch
Option 3: proteins
Option 4: minerals

Correct Answer: fat
Solution : The correct option is fat.
Cholesterol is a waxy, fat-like molecule found in the body's cells. It is required for several body activities, including the synthesis of hormones, vitamin D, and bile acids. Cholesterol can be gained through diet or produced by the body. Maintaining a healthy cholesterol balance is essential for general health. Diet, physical exercise, and heredity are all factors that might affect cholesterol levels.
